PORT CHALMERS.

(From oar own Correspondent.) This day. Arrival of an English Ship. The ship Cora, Captain Linn, from London, arrived at the Heads after a passage of. 103 days. She will be towed in this afternoon. Sailed : Easby, for Sydney, via the coast, with 46 passengers.
